Output 676638559ede124a2690b9265a92bbf08104c55f535dff4ed4eaf14249959583:2

value
35000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c06743f10e844238f74ab81ede440cda77ef548c OP_EQUAL
address
3KEMNP397298nTvgARdCSk3PKHY6QyKrwN
transaction
676638559ede124a2690b9265a92bbf08104c55f535dff4ed4eaf14249959583
spent
false

79 Sat Ranges